What kind of catterpillar is this?
This caterpillar appears to be in the subfamily Arctiinae of the moth family Erebidae. The image is not clear enough for a positive i.d.; possibilities include the Virginian tiger moth, Spilosoma virginica (see http://tinyurl.com/yhr7pqh), and the salt marsh caterpillar, Estigmene acrea (see http://tinyurl.com/2cv9we4). Caterpillars of both these species can be highly variable in appearance.
